WebMar 14, 2024 · The pulmonary veins drain oxygenated blood from the lungs to the left atrium. A small amount of blood is also drained from the lungs by the bronchial veins. Gross anatomy There are typically four pulmonary veins, two draining each lung: right superior: drains the right upper and middle lobes right inferior: drains the right lower lobe
